Destinations and day trips from Lucolena: Florence, Chianti, and beyond

Lucolena’s value as a business traveler is amplified by its proximity to Florence. A short drive or a quick regional train ride gives you access to world-class museums, Renaissance architectural wonders, and a lively dining scene after your workday ends. Florence is about 30–40 minutes away by car, depending on traffic, and the city’s compact historic center makes it feasible to combine business appointments with an evening cultural excursion. For those who want to step off the beaten path, the surrounding countryside offers a string of scenic towns, vineyards, and olive oil estates that define the Tuscan experience.

In addition to Florence, consider a day in the Chianti wine region. Vineyards perched on rolling hills, cypress-lined driveways, and medieval villages provide a perfect backdrop for a relaxed client dinner or a private wine tasting that can be arranged in partnership with your accommodations. The area around Lucolena is part of Tuscany’s celebrated wine-and-food landscape, where a short drive can lead to olive oil mills, farm-to-table restaurants, and artisan workshops. If you crave nature, the Apennine foothills and forested valleys nearby offer hiking routes that vary from gentle riverside walks to more challenging treks—each with a chance to pause, reflect, and recharge your batteries between back-to-back meetings.
